One Laptop Per Child

Alberto sent me this link about Negroponte’s effort at installing and integrating computer technology into high poverty communities, “One Laptop Per Child.”
This open source laptop is designed to grow in the hands of the users, with every piece of software open and maleable, with no proprietary interventions. “This really is something new in the history of computing. It’s the economics of scale involved in producing an open platform in the hundreds of millions a year that will change things. This isn’t the same as the Linux community begging existing vendors like Dell and HP to pre-install Linux on existing laptops; this is a new open platform designed around Free Software.”
